Mumbai is situated on India's west coast along the Arabian Sea. As the capital of Maharashtra, it serves as India's financial, commercial, and entertainment hub. Home to over 21 million people, this vibrant metropolis was built on seven islands merged through land reclamation.
November to February is ideal for visiting Mumbai. During these winter months, temperatures range from 16°C to 33°C with low humidity and minimal rainfall, perfect for sightseeing and outdoor activities.
Gateway of India: Mumbai's iconic monument built in 1924, overlooking the Arabian Sea.
Marine Drive: The "Queen's Necklace" - a 3.6 km boulevard perfect for sunset views.
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Terminus: UNESCO World Heritage Site and stunning Victorian Gothic railway station.
Elephanta Caves: Ancient 5th-8th century rock-cut temples on Elephanta Island, accessible by ferry from Gateway of India.
Juhu Beach: Popular beach famous for street food like pav bhaji and bhel puri.
Colaba Causeway: Vibrant shopping street for jewelry, clothing, antiques, and handicrafts.
Local Trains: Mumbai's lifeline carrying 7.5+ million passengers daily on Western, Central, and Harbour lines.

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j International Airport (BOM): Located in Andheri East, 28 km from Central Mumbai. India's second-busiest airport handling 55+ million passengers annually. Two terminals - Terminal 1 (domestic) and Terminal 2 (international & domestic).
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Terminus (CST): Historic railway station and UNESCO World Heritage Site serving Central Railway lines.
Mumbai Central: Major station for Western Railway connecting to Gujarat, Rajasthan, and North India.
Bandra Terminus: Long-distance trains to western and northern India.
Lokmanya Tilak Terminus (LTT): Major terminus in Kurla for trains to South India and eastern regions.

Terminal 1 (Santacruz): Domestic flights only. Serves IndiGo, SpiceJet, Akasa Air. 15 million passenger capacity. Note: Scheduled for demolition and reconstruction starting 2025-26.
Terminal 2 (Sahar): International and domestic flights. 40 million passenger capacity (expanding to 45 million). Serves all international carriers and Air India domestic flights. Award-winning X-shaped design with 192 check-in counters and extensive shopping/dining.
Important: Terminals are 5 km apart. Transfer takes 20-30 minutes by free shuttle bus (24/7 with valid ticket).
Terminal 2 - GVK Lounge: Asia's best airport lounge. 30,000 sq ft with buffet, bar, complimentary spa (15-min business class, 30-min first class), showers, private dining for first class.

Pune is located in western India on the Deccan Plateau at an elevation of 560 meters. As Maharashtra's second-largest city and former capital of the Maratha Empire, it serves as a major educational and IT hub, earning the nickname "Oxford of the East". Home to over 7.2 million people in the metropolitan area, this cosmopolitan city is known for its pleasant climate, rich history, and thriving startup ecosystem.
October to February is ideal for visiting Pune. During these months, temperatures range from 11°C to 23°C with pleasant weather and minimal rainfall, perfect for exploring the city's forts, gardens, and outdoor attractions. March to May sees warmer weather (20°C-36°C).
Shaniwar Wada: 18th-century palace fort built in 1736 by Peshwa Bajirao I. Though destroyed by fire in 1827, the fortification walls and grand gates remain impressive. Evening light and sound show available. Open 8 AM to 6:30 PM.
Aga Khan Palace: Built in 1892, this monument of Indian freedom struggle housed Mahatma Gandhi, Kasturba Gandhi, and Mahadev Desai during Quit India Movement. Now a museum with Gandhi's artifacts. Open 9 AM to 5:30 PM.
Sinhagad Fort: Historic fort 25 km from Pune at 1,312 meters elevation, over 2000 years old. Famous for the Battle of Sinhagad (1670). Popular trekking destination with panoramic views.
Dagdusheth Halwai Ganapati Temple: Famous Ganesh temple with idol adorned with 40 kg gold. Major pilgrimage site during Ganesh festival.
Rajiv Gandhi Zoological Park: 130-acre zoo in Katraj with 60 species. Open 10 AM to 6 PM. Entry: Rs. 20 adults, Rs. 10 children.
Raja Dinkar Kelkar Museum: Three-story museum with over 15,000 artifacts including 14th-century sculptures, ornaments, musical instruments, and cultural objects.
Osho Ashram: World-renowned meditation center in Koregaon Park based on Osho's teachings.
Mulshi Lake and Dam: Scenic dam 50 km from Pune surrounded by Sahyadri ranges. Spectacular during monsoon. Open 9 AM to 6 PM.
Pune Metro: Two operational lines covering 31.25 km - Line 1 (Pimpri to Swargate) and Line 2 (Vanaz to Ramwadi). Opened March 2022. Operates 5 AM to 11 PM.
PMPML Buses: Over 2,000 buses covering 381 routes. Fully green fleet with CNG and electric buses. Daily ridership 10-11 lakh passengers. Special services include Rainbow BRT routes, night buses, women-only Tejaswini buses, and airport shuttles.
Auto-Rickshaws: Metered three-wheelers. Base fare Rs. 30 plus 15-17 per km. Apps like Ola, Uber, Rapido available.

Single Integrated Terminal: Opened in 2009, handles both domestic and international flights. Capacity of 9 million passengers annually. Features modern check-in counters, baggage handling systems, and 3 levels (Arrivals - Ground Floor, Departures - First Floor, Retail/Dining - Mezzanine). Domestic and international sections well-segregated with separate security and immigration areas.

Cleartrip’s cancellation and refund policies depend on the airline and ticket type. Cancellations are subject to airline charges, plus Cleartrip's non-refundable fee (INR 300 for domestic, INR 649 for international bookings). Refunds must be requested through Cleartrip, as airlines won’t process refunds for Cleartrip bookings. No shows or partially used tickets are non-refundable. For online cancellations, you can use your Cleartrip account; offline cancellations incur higher fees.
